    Macka you have to be kidding, Orlando has many very fine restaraunts, some of which I have not been able to match here in the UK (of France for that!)

    In no order of preference here is a good selection for you:

    Vicoria and Alberts - Grand Floridian
    Citricoes - Grand Floridian
    Normans - Grand Lakes resort
    Primo- Grand Lakes resort
    Emerils Chop Chop - Universal
    Christini's - Doctor Phillips
    Seasons 52 - Doctor Phillips
    California Grill - Disneys Contempory Resort
    Ruth's Chris Steakhouse
    Foultons Crab House Downtown Disney
    Old Hickory Steak House - Gaylord Palms
    Bohmeme - Westin Orlando

    I could go on...................
